  1. I reckon he says what he thinks quite consistently in the public arena. Interesting the boys taking with him on Triple M. Garry for about the 864th time was asked why he doesn't "help the club more" Garry basically responded by saying there is no logical reason he would be good at any board level role. He stated he has no relevant diplomas nor abilities, and importantly said that facts and figures "do no interest him" which i think many peope can relate to. He said that if the club needed him for membership drives, he urged them to "use him in any way, shape or form that will help the club" and also said if they wanted his opinion on the list management of the MFC then he would help as he feels this is more in his area of expertise. I think he's doing the right thing by the club. He is not simply saying, I'm G. Lyon, i'm a legend of the club, i demand a spot wherever, but rather he is letting the proper people do their jobs while he gives us the most prominent public figure since... probably since i've been alive. I think he may begin to step up his commitment off field as our membership drive changes course, and our list is evaluated, but other than that i hope he continues to give us a face in the media and plugs the Demons whenever he can

  11. 16th ranked forwardline, 16th ranked forwardline, and i'm absolutely with Nasher on this. A good quality midfield that pressues the opposition midfield not only lowers the number of entries into our defensive 50, but lowers the quality at which it comes in. This was seen starkly in the midfield performance deteriorating the quality of Hawthorn's forward entries, whilst against the Saints, our backline did not stand a chance. The way to judge our backline is to rate how the players are going. Garland is basically unrecognisable, as is Warnock, Frawley i think is still finding his place, Bell is struggling a bit but i think it's largely a form issue. Rivers has been injured and so our backline/team's most important players has not been able to help the structure. Our team is being groomed for a new future, with a new structure and stye of play, and thus no individual part should be rated aside from any other.
